Jamnagar (Gujarat) [India], June 11 (ANI):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Mohan Yadav on Wednesday praised Prime Minister Narendra Modi on completion of 11 years in office, terming it a golden tenure.
He further stressed that there have been various achievements in PM Modi's tenure which were awaited for a very long time ago.
'PM Modi's tenure is a Golden tenure. There have been several achievements in PM Narendra Modi's tenure that were needed for a very long time. He formed the government for the third time and this is not just the tenure of PM Narendra Modi, but the tenure which makes the entire India proud,' CM Yadav told reporters here.
He also highlighted that he came to visit the rescue centre in Jamnagar and would like to work with them in time to come.
Earlier in the day ahead of the visit, CM Yadav while speaking to reporters in Bhopal emphasised Madhya Pradesh's focus on wildlife conservation, sustainable habitat development, and expanding veterinary infrastructure to protect its rich biodiversity.
'From a wildlife perspective, we have a vast forest area, and because of that, Madhya Pradesh is home to the highest number of animals like tigers, leopards, vultures, and many more. We have also brought King Cobra to the state. In such a situation, it's important to ensure the safety of the growing animal population and rescue centers are required. Recently we have developed two new tiger reserves in the state,' CM Yadav said.
'Additionally, for Cheetahs, after Kuno National Park, we have shifted some of them to Gandhi Sagar Wildlife Sanctuary and we are developing a new park. I have asked our officers to establish a rescue center at the divisional level. Currently our only rescue center is at Van Vihar National Park in state capital Bhopal. Similarly, with the increasing number of tourists, our zoos should also expand. From that perspective, we had announced the development of two new zoos in the last budget as well,' he added.
'Today, I am going to see one of the best rescue centres in the whole country which is located in Gujarat today. Earlier, I sent a team from the state and we will hope to exchange our animals among ourselves which we have in abundance. Also, if they can help in saving our animals with their rescue facilities,' CM Yadav said.
He also emphasised that they tried to start veterinary courses and to open veterinary hospitals in the Universities, so that veterinarians related to wildlife can also be produced. (ANI)
